Magnitude 7.4 quake hits western Colombia, killing at least 111 people
- A 7.4-magnitude earthquake struck western Colombia near San José del Palmar in Chocó, at a depth of about 107 kilometers, with tremors felt across major cities including Bogotá.
- At least 111 people were killed and 87 injured, while additional victims remained trapped beneath collapsed buildings as rescue operations continued.
- The earthquake caused major structural damage in several cities, particularly in the Risaralda region and Cali, while flights were temporarily suspended at several airports for safety inspections.
- President Abelardo de la Espriella declared a national state of emergency, deploying government resources with the immediate priority of rescuing survivors and assisting affected communities.

Tower of Colombia’s tallest cathedral collapses after 7.4-magnitude earthquake
A cathedral tower in Colombia collapsed following a 7.4-magnitude earthquake that struck the north-west of the country on Monday (10 August). Footage circulated on social media showed one of the side towers of Manizales' iconic cathedral collapsed following the quake. Its facade was visibly damaged, and debris was scattered on the streets nearby. The Catedral Basílica Metropolitana Nuestra Senora del Rosario is the tallest cathedral in Colombia.…
